THS September Consultant of the Month

Colton “Cole” Broome, who serves as a front desk manager at the Courtyard by Marriott Ithaca Airport/University, in Ithaca, New York, brings more than 12 years of hospitality experience to every assignment. Since joining THS in 2023, Cole has completed more than 17 successful task force placements, consistently showing up with a strong work ethic, the desire to mentor and a positive spirit that uplifts every property he supports.

A career sparked by a family connection

Born and raised in Orlando, Florida, Cole’s journey into hospitality began straight out of high school when he landed his first job as an overnight laundry attendant through a family friend in hotel management. He learned firsthand the importance of detail, efficiency and resilience.

That early role lit a fire in Cole to continue learning and growing within the industry. He transitioned to the front desk and over time progressed into supervisory roles in front office, food and beverage, banquet operations and sales coordination. His well-rounded experience prepared him for leadership as an assistant general manager where he brought all those skills together to support teams and properties in a larger way.

A lasting impression of task force leadership

Early in his career, Cole saw the true impact of task force professionals. While working at a property undergoing renovations and operating without a general manager, he witnessed task force leaders step in to provide structure, confidence, and continuity. That moment stuck with him and shaped his own career aspirations.

Today Cole carries that inspiration into every THS assignment, approaching each property with professionalism, humility and dedication. He’s known for being approachable, dependable and someone who makes each day better for the team around him.
